Ishan Kishan 2.0: The method behind the mayhem
Ishan Kishan's return to domestic cricket has revitalised his career, showcasing a fearless yet methodical approach. After being axed from the Indian setup in 2023, his dedication to First Class cricket and strong performances in limited-overs tournaments have put him back in contention, demonstrating a significant improvement in his game.

Google’s ex CEO Eric Schmidt warns America: We are running out of electricity
Former Google CEO Eric Schmidt warns America faces an electricity shortage, needing 92 gigawatts more power for AI growth. Massive data centers are straining the grid, with projections showing significant increases in consumption and costs. Tech giants are pledging to cover electricity expenses amid these growing concerns.

Hampi rape-murder: Trio sentenced to death for raping Israeli tourist and her host, killing guide
In a landmark ruling, a Karnataka court has sentenced three individuals to death for the heinous gang rape of an Israeli tourist alongside an Indian woman, as well as the murder of a man from Odisha last year. The presiding judge classified the crime as the 'rarest of rare,' affirming that the prosecution presented irrefutable evidence of their guilt.
